Find 2 Star Hotels in Cahokia, IL from AED 197
- Change your mindBook hotels with free cancellation
- Be pickySearch almost a million properties worldwide
Check availability on Cahokia 2 Star Hotels
Compare Cahokia 2 Star Hotels with updated room rates, reviews, and availability. Most hotels are fully refundable.

Pear Tree Inn St. Louis Airport
St. Ann
9.4 out of 10, Exceptional, (2727)
The price is AED 331
AED 389 total
includes taxes & fees
24 Nov - 25 Nov

Hampton Inn St. Louis-Downtown (At the Gateway Arch)
Downtown St. Louis
8.6 out of 10, Excellent, (1143)
The price is AED 350
AED 409 total
includes taxes & fees
29 Nov - 30 Nov

Red Roof Inn PLUS+ St Louis - Forest Park/ Hampton Ave
The Hill
5.8 out of 10, (1001)
The price is AED 270
AED 315 total
includes taxes & fees
23 Nov - 24 Nov

Motel 6 Hazelwood, MO
Hazelwood
8.4 out of 10, Very Good, (1532)
The price is AED 223
AED 273 total
includes taxes & fees
3 Dec - 4 Dec

Super 8 by Wyndham O'Fallon
O'Fallon
7.2 out of 10, Good, (1005)
The price is AED 172
AED 197 total
includes taxes & fees
7 Dec - 8 Dec

Wingate by Wyndham St. Louis Airport
St. Ann
9.2 out of 10, Wonderful, (1483)
The price is AED 396
AED 467 total
includes taxes & fees
23 Nov - 24 Nov

Best Western St. Louis Inn
St. Louis
8.0 out of 10, Very Good, (1007)
The price is AED 265
AED 305 total
includes taxes & fees
30 Nov - 1 Dec

Best Western Plus St. Louis Airport Hotel
Woodson Terrace
9.2 out of 10, Wonderful, (1005)
The price is AED 372
AED 461 total
includes taxes & fees
24 Nov - 25 Nov
Save an average of 15% on thousands of hotels when you're signed in
Explore similar 3-star hotels
Many 3-star hotels have the same amenities as 2-star hotels. See all 3-star hotels in Cahokia.

Forest Park Hotel by MDR
5915 Wilson Ave St. Louis MO
7.4/10 Good! (1,227 reviews)
Still don't see what you're looking for?
See all properties in Cahokia.
You can also use these popular filters to refine your search.
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.
Top Cahokia Hotel Reviews
Explore a world of travel with Expedia
Cahokia Hotels by Star Rating
Hotels in Cahokia Neighborhoods
Stay near popular Cahokia attractions
- Hotels near Arsenal BG Ballpark
- Hotels near Greater St. Louis Air & Space Museum
- Hotels near St. Louis Union Station
- Hotels near Gateway Arch
- Hotels near St. Louis Zoo
- Hotels near Enterprise Center
- Hotels near Busch Stadium
- Hotels near Dome at America’s Center
- Hotels near Washington University in St. Louis
- Hotels near City Museum
- Hotels near Forest Park
- Hotels near Barnes Jewish Hospital
- Hotels near America's Center Convention Complex
- Hotels near Mississippi River
- Hotels near St. Louis University
- Hotels near Fox Theater
- Hotels near Hollywood Casino Amphitheatre
- Hotels near Horseshoe St. Louis Casino
- Hotels near Westport Plaza
- Hotels near Saint Louis Galleria Mall
More Hotel Options in Cahokia
- Adventure Hotels in Cahokia
- Business Hotels in Cahokia
- Casinos in Cahokia
- Cheap Hotels in Cahokia
- Family Hotels in Cahokia
- Golf Hotels in Cahokia
- Historic Hotels in Cahokia
- Hotels with Bars in Cahokia
- Hotels with Free Parking in Cahokia
- Hotels with Hot Tubs in Cahokia
- Hotels with WiFi in Cahokia
- Hotels with a Pool in Cahokia
- Hotels with an Indoor Pool in Cahokia
- Luxury Hotels in Cahokia
- Pet-friendly Hotels in Cahokia
- Shopping Hotels in Cahokia
Explore more hotels
- Home2 Suites by Hilton St. Louis Downtown
- AC Hotel St. Louis Clayton
- Live by Loews - St.Louis
- Angad Arts Hotel St. Louis, Tapestry Collection by Hilton
- Renaissance St. Louis Airport Hotel
- The Cheshire
- La Quinta Inn & Suites by Wyndham St. Louis Westport
- DoubleTree by Hilton St. Louis Forest Park
- Hampton Inn St. Louis-Downtown (At the Gateway Arch)
- Marriott St. Louis Grand
- Drury Inn & Suites St. Louis Union Station
- Courtyard by Marriott St. Louis Downtown/Convention Center
- St. Louis Airport Hotel
- St. Louis Union Station Hotel, Curio Collection by Hilton
- Hilton St. Louis Frontenac
- The Royal Sonesta Chase Park Plaza St. Louis
- Embassy Suites by Hilton St. Louis Downtown
- The Westin St. Louis
- Crowne Plaza St. Louis Airport by IHG
- Motel 6 Hazelwood, MO










































































